Spirit, EXTREMUM, Nemiga, and Winstrike were handed spots at the tournament which will take place on March 19-21.

Following the announcement of regional qualifiers for North America, Latin America, and Western Europe, details regarding the CIS-based tournament, which will give out an invite to BLAST Premier Spring Showdown, have been unveiled.

The tournament is run by Winstrike, who cooperated with BLAST on the 2020 CIS Cup and BLAST Pro Series Moscow 2019. Among invited teams is Winstrike's CS:GO roster, ranked 22nd in the world, as well as the Australian side EXTREMUM, whose organization is based in Russia.

The Australians will be fighting CIS sides for a spot in the Showdown

The final two invited teams are Nemiga, the Belarussian side that peaked at No.21 in the rankings late in 2020, and Spirit, who entered the top 10 of the world rankings after impressing in DreamHack Open January and IEM Katowice earlier this year.

Four additional teams will earn their spots in the Winstrike CIS Spring Cup, scheduled for March 19-21, through an open qualifier taking place on Friday, March 12.

The winner of the Winstrike CIS Spring Cup will earn $25,000 and a spot in the BLAST Premier Spring Showdown, in which squads such as Astralis and Vitality await.
